A recent study by the American Optometric Association shows two thirds of people didn't list UV protection for their eyes as an important factor when selecting
designer sunglasses .
Here are some ways you can prevent damage to your vision. Experts say wear protective
eyewear any time your eyes are exposed to the sun.
Make sure your
designer sunglasses or contact lenses block 99 to 100 percent of UV-A and UV-B radiation. Also look for
designer sunglasses that have solid color lenses.
Experts say it's also important for infants to wear protective glasses. They say teens and younger children are the most at risk because they spend more time in the sun.
Experts also say it's important to wear protective
designer sunglasses even in winter. Overexposure to UV rays in the winter can do similar damage to the eyes, just like in the summer months.
